In Colorado and in some other states, medical marijuana is legal. In Boulder, there is a dispensary practically on every corner. You have to be 18 or older to get a "license" from your doctor, which allows you to purchase a rather large amount of pot each month, way more than most people need for their multitude of conditions ("over 250," according to medicalmarijuanadispensary.net). These conditions include:
• Back/Joint Pain
• Depression
• Anxiety
• Premenstrual syndrome
• Crohn's disease
• Insomnia
• Nausea
• Anorexia
• Arthritis
• Cancer
• HIV/Aids
• Gastrointestinal Diseases
• Movement Disorders
I totally believe that there are many legitimate uses for medical marijuana, and that many people are helped by it. On a proportionate basis, however, considering that Boulder is filled with such healthy, active, athletic people, it makes no sense that there is a need for so many marijuana dispensaries!
